The 1881 Census reveals a detailed snapshot of households in England, Wales and Scotland. The census was taken on April 3rd and the total population was recorded as 29,707,207.
In the 1881 Census, the household of David Findlay, born in 1839 in Tealing, Forfarshire (Angus), consisted of 6 members. David was the head of the household, married to Margaret Hughes, born in 1846 in Mains, Forfarshire (Angus), Scotland. They had 4 children; Emma (born 1866 in Dundee, Forfarshire (Angus), Scotland), Maggie (born 1869 in Dundee, Forfarshire (Angus), Scotland), James (born 1873 in Dundee, Forfarshire (Angus), Scotland) and George (born 1878 in Dundee, Forfarshire (Angus), Scotland).
